Krusch Fades Terekek's Outs

Level 13 : Blinds 1,500/3,000, 3,000 ante

Dennis Krusch made it 6,000 from early position with the cutoff player making the call. Hussein Terekek jammed for 15,000 from the small blind, and Krusch moved in over the top for roughly 50,000. The cutoff player took a few moments before folding and revealing the A.

Hussein Terekek: A2 All in
Dennis Krusch: 1010

Terekek was far behind the pocket tens of Krusch, but the 353 flop provided him with a lot more outs to stay alive. However, the remainder of the board came Q6, and all of Terekek's stack was sent over to Krusch.
